在当今这个信息化迅猛发展的时代,服务器的稳定性、安全性和效率成为了企业和服务提供商面临的核心挑战。服务器场景分析,是指通过深入研究和理解服务器运行的环境、应用需求、潜在问题和性能瓶颈,以便采取相应的优化措施。本文将为你提供一套高效的服务器场景分析方法,包括策略制定、实施步骤和常见问题的解决方案,旨在帮助你快速定位并解决服务器相关问题。
理解服务器场景分析的重要性
服务器场景分析是确保服务器持续稳定运行的关键。通过分析,可以发现并解决潜在的性能问题,提高系统资源的利用率,增强数据安全性和系统的可用性。分析结果还能帮助企业做出更为明智的决策,如服务器升级、迁移和负载均衡。
策略制定:如何制定分析策略
1.明确分析目标
在开始分析之前,首先需要明确目标。这包括但不限于提高响应速度、优化资源分配、增强数据处理能力和提升安全防护等级。
2.选择合适的分析工具
选择合适的服务器监控和分析工具是执行场景分析的关键。常用的工具有Nagios、Zabbix、Prometheus等,它们可以帮助你实时监控服务器的性能指标。
3.制定分析流程
确定分析流程,包括数据收集、性能监测、问题诊断、优化建议和实施反馈等环节。每一个环节都要有明确的操作步骤和时间安排。
实施步骤:深入分析服务器的每一个角落
1.收集系统信息
使用命令如`top`,`vmstat`,`iostat`,`free`等工具收集当前服务器的CPU、内存、磁盘IO和网络IO等关键资源的使用情况。
```bash
top查看系统负载情况
vmstat5每5秒输出一次内存、CPU等信息
iostat-xz1每1秒输出磁盘IO统计信息
free-m查看内存使用情况
```
2.性能监测
通过设置阈值,对系统进行持续监测,并记录性能瓶颈发生的时间点,为后续的分析提供数据支持。
3.定位问题所在
对收集到的数据进行深入分析,利用分析工具找出系统瓶颈。如果CPU使用率长期处于高位,可能需要优化程序代码或增加硬件资源。
4.生成优化建议
根据监测结果,提出改进方案。如果确定是数据库查询导致性能下降,可以考虑优化SQL查询语句或升级数据库硬件。
5.实施优化
根据建议执行优化操作。实施后,持续监测性能,确保优化措施有效。
6.反馈与调整
在实施优化后,收集反馈信息,如果优化效果未达到预期,需要重新分析并调整策略。
常见问题解答
Q:如果服务器出现性能急剧下降,应该如何快速定位问题?
A:首先检查系统监控工具中的报警信息,然后根据报警信息查看相关系统日志,快速定位到可能的故障点。如果发现大量500错误,可能需要检查web服务器的日志;如果是磁盘空间不足,需要清理磁盘空间或增加磁盘容量。
Q:如何保证服务器场景分析的持续性和高效性?
A:将服务器场景分析纳入日常运维的一部分,设置固定周期(如每周或每月)进行分析。同时,利用自动化工具进行数据收集和分析,提高效率。
结语
通过上述策略和步骤的执行,你可以对服务器进行深入的场景分析,从而及时发现并解决服务器潜在的问题,保证系统的稳定和高效运行。记住,服务器场景分析是一个持续的过程,需要你不断地监测、优化并调整策略以适应不断变化的业务需求和技术环境。希望本文为你提供了有效的指导和实用的技巧,帮助你在服务器管理的道路上更进一步。
标签: #服务器